Title: Studies of $B^0$ Decays for Measuring $\sin(2\beta)$

Abstract: Future asymmetric $e^{+}e^{-} \rightarrow \Upsilon$(4S) $B$ factoriesare being constructed to search for CP violation in $B^0$ decays. It is hoped that a CP asymmetry may be observed in $B^0\mbox{--}\overline{B}^0$ mixing in analogy with that found in neutral kaons. In this mixing measurement, $B^0$ decays to CP eigenstates, such as the rare decay $B^0 \rightarrow \psi K_S$, may provide information on the CKM angle $\sin(2\beta)$. I discuss decay additional CP eigenstate branching ratios measured by the CLEO experiment that may be used by future $B$ factories to measure $\sin(2\beta)$.
